Uses very little wattage and still boils well
We got this from the last power outage where a car with V2L would only power max 3kw. Most of the kettles go above that (our normal one does 2500W but will hit 3kw during the first part of the cycle and then stop heating when using V2L). I looked around and this one looks nice, feels light enough and boils in about 1 minute (maybe 2 big mugs?). There were stains in the bottom after the first time testing the boil, which I would say is normal. I washed it beforehand but still, it just looks like water stains from the heat. I don't mind. It's now in an emergency outage box with candles, but as it looks good and is light, we're considering bringing it with us to hotels. Not that we've experienced issues with hotel kettles, but you do at least know where yours has been, it looks good, doesn't weight much and as long as you remember to bring it home (!!) then it's a nice, safe feeling.

Brilliant little kettle.
There’s not a lot of choice for low wattage kettles and the ones available are not exactly a piece of art like regular kettles, but out of all the choice and spec I wanted, this one ticked the box. I think it’s the best looking one by far. Very cute and a modern design. It’s not a big brand but it looks the part. I like that it has colour choices that the others don’t. I feel the others are more a necessity for the travel market and haven’t given any thought to the design for people like myself that want one in their kitchen. I love that this one doesn’t have an element to clog up. It’s just a stainless steel tubular cavity which looks very easy to clean. I also like that it’s just a plug in, that I can choose to hide the cable if I want. Compared to others that may seem practical by taking the kettle off the base to fill it, or like one small one I’ve seen where the cable is attached to the kettle which makes no sense. My old kettle, a Buffolo of which very similar ones are now available, was a lift off one which always got stuck on the base so I didn’t want another plus it’s extra cleaning. And it leaked when pouring. We bought it for the caravan but when we got solar panels we decided to use it in the house to cut down on what we use. That’s why I’ve gone for another low voltage one. We probably only boil it once a day for drinks and I use it for boiling water in cooking when needed. Boiling a 3kW kettle for a couple of minutes is probably a similar cost to boiling a low wattage for 6 minutes but when you’re working with what solar you are downloading it can make a difference between buying from the grid or using your solar. I boiled the max of 800ml and it took 6:50.38 minutes, compared to my 900W 1ltr kettle which took 6:20.65 to boil 800ml. But I think I could have pulled it off at just under 6 mins as it seemed to boil fully for ages before it clicked off, which my other doesn’t. I was watching it for nearly 2 minutes thinking surely it’s going to turn off any second now, but it didn’t. I’ll have to test it without the lid.
